This Vegan Banana Cake is moist, flavorful, and perfect for any occasion. Whether as a dessert or a sweet treat with your afternoon tea, this cake is sure to be a crowd-pleaser.

Vegan Banana Cake

Ingredients:

For the Cake:

  • 3 ripe bananas, mashed
  • 1/2 cup plant-based milk (such as almond, soy, or coconut)
  • 1 teaspoon apple cider vinegar
  • 1/3 cup melted coconut oil or vegetable oil
  • 1 teaspoon vanilla extract
  • 1 1/2 cups all-purpose flour
  • 1 teaspoon baking soda
  • 1/2 teaspoon baking powder
  • 1/2 teaspoon salt
  • 1/2 cup granulated sugar
  • 1/2 cup brown sugar, packed

For the Frosting:

  • 1/4 cup vegan butter, softened
  • 2 cups powdered sugar
  • 1 teaspoon vanilla extract
  • 2-3 tablespoons plant-based milk

Instructions:

1. Preheat the Oven:

  • Preheat your oven to 350°F (175°C). Grease and flour a 9×9-inch square cake pan.

2. Prepare the Wet Ingredients:

  • In a bowl, mix together mashed bananas, plant-based milk, apple cider vinegar, melted coconut oil or vegetable oil, and vanilla extract.

3. Combine Dry Ingredients:

  • In a separate bowl, whisk together flour, baking soda, baking powder, and salt.

4. Mix Wet and Dry Ingredients:

  • Add the dry ingredients to the wet ingredients, mixing until just combined. Be careful not to overmix.

5. Add Sugar:

  • Add both granulated sugar and brown sugar to the batter, stirring until well incorporated.

6. Pour into Cake Pan:

  • Pour the batter into the prepared cake pan, spreading it evenly.

7. Bake:

  • Bake in the preheated oven for 25-30 minutes or until a toothpick inserted into the center comes out clean.

8. Make the Frosting:

  • While the cake is cooling, prepare the frosting. In a bowl, beat together softened vegan butter, powdered sugar, vanilla extract, and plant-based milk until smooth and creamy.

9. Frost the Cake:

  • Once the cake has cooled, spread the frosting evenly over the top.
  • Add sliced bananas on top (optional)

10. Serve and Enjoy:

  • Slice and serve your delicious vegan banana cake. Enjoy!
Prep Time
20 Minutes
Cook Time
40 Minutes
Total Time
1 hr 0 mins
Yield
1 Cake
Share: